Where Wangs's grants concentrate

Wangs Alliance Corporation is a focused PatentsView assignee: 20 CPC subclasses with 50.8% of grants classified under F21V (Functional Features OR Details OF Lighting Devices OR Systems THEREOF; Structural Combinations OF Lighting Devices With Other Articles, NOT Otherwise Provided FOR). Peak complete grant year is 2023 (40 grants) versus a trough of 1 in 2017. By volume, Wangs sits between Self Electronics Co., Ltd. and Basf Plant Science Company GmbH.

Wangs's three-year grant acceleration

Wangs Alliance Corporation shows 81 grants in 2022–2024 against only 16 in 2019–2021. That prior window is too thin for a growth multiple (rename and spin-out assignees look artificially high when the baseline is near zero), so PlainPatent withholds a ranked acceleration claim here.

Wangs Alliance Corporation patent grants by year, 2015–2025
Year Patents Granted Share of Period
2017 1 0.8%
2018 1 0.8%
2019 6 4.6%
2020 2 1.5%
2021 8 6.2%
2022 6 4.6%
2023 40 30.8%
2024 35 26.9%
2025partial year 31 23.8%
